December 4 – December 5, 2019
7:00 am to 7:00 am
 

Moose Jaw Police responded to 33 calls for service.

8:25 am – Break and Enter – Sometime overnight someone entered a business compound and broke into a C-Can, police continue to investigate.

9:02 am – Theft of Auto – Sometime since Monday evening a garage had been broken into and a vehicle was stolen. The vehicle was later recovered and the items were seized for processing.

11:11 am – Mischief – Sometime yesterday a vehicle windshield was damaged, possibly by a BB. The damage is estimated at $1,000.

11:27 am – Theft – There was theft of different items out of a rental unit. Police continue to investigate.

11:50 am – Break and Enter – Sometime overnight someone entered a garage through an unlocked man door. The vehicles were gone through but nothing appears to have been taken.

12:01 pm – Driving Dangerous – There was a report of a vehicle ripping around the parking lot of a school with plate number obtained. The vehicle was located and the occupants were spoken to and warned about their actions.

12:06 pm – Assistance to Sick Person – The subject was located and transported to the hospital and left in the care of hospital staff.

2:25 pm – Shoplifting – Yesterday someone had stolen some merchandise and returned it to the business today. It is unknown if anything had been taken today. Police continue to investigate.

3:38 pm – Driving Dangerous – There was a report of a vehicle speeding and running lights, last seen headed east on Highway 1. A plate number was obtained. This is still under investigation to speak to the registered owner.

3:50 pm – Fraud – There was a report of a fraud, and police continue to investigate.

8:50 pm – Fare Fraud – A subject obtained a ride from a taxi but skipped out on paying the fare. This is still under investigation for charges.

9:01 pm – Dispute – The subject was upset but had calmed down prior to police arrival. Police spoke to all parties involved and discussed options.

10:31 pm – There was a report of someone banging on a door. There was no one there upon police arrival. The area was searched and no one was located.

1:37 am – Noise Bylaw – There was a report of upstairs neighbours stomping around and keeping neighbours awake. The tenant was spoken to and warned to keep it down.

3:37 am – Property Dispute – One subject took another’s bed. This was reported for information purposes.

4:41 am – Well-Being Check – The subject was located in fine health.

Police responded to five 911 calls.
Police completed one curfew check.
PACT responded on three occasions.
